Output 762a8f56923e82d0fdc4a80d2cffff92618e591c20a40742f0fdf77e7ae9a53b:11

value
40668016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 197a5e494e3c665c22daebb1bfef6a5cff6aceb1 OP_EQUAL
address
341jQdz5ezPbhoCmBmKBZ5v777uwAYNbvc
transaction
762a8f56923e82d0fdc4a80d2cffff92618e591c20a40742f0fdf77e7ae9a53b
spent
true